<p>The (newer) SW5548 was harder on over current protection, mainly because</p>
<p>it could put out more current than the SW4048... <br>
</p>
<p>One trick to try is to place a long(ish) extension cord between the SW and the load to give it a wee bit of series resistance.</p>
<p>Doing this would often reduce that OCP and help motors to start.<br>

<div dir="ltr">Does your air compressor have an unloader valve, or can you install one?
<div>That should do the trick, sounds like you are just running into the regular high surge current demand.</div>
<div>Off the grid, compressors are in about the same nasty league as old well pumps as far as surge demand.</div>

I've got an SW+5548 that will barley start my air compressor. Once it does run it shows 17 Amps on the inverters loads meter. During start up it reads 60+ amps.<br>
Do you think better capacitors would help the situation?<br>
BTW I've never ran the compressor off grid prior.<br>
I even tried #8 from the Breaker to the pressure switch, about 9ft, with no benefit. The compressor will only start with the tank completely empty.<br>
